IanS
10-25-08, 05:39 AM
There are a number of free pieces of software that can create PDF files (although not the all singing and dancing versions) out there. They are often installed as 'printers' although they save files.

The oneI have installed is Primo PDF (http://www.primopdf.com/) although it isn't the only one available. Search for 'create PDF'
